Transaction f850633d74c3f421902a5ea745d36eac0035ab70368cc60c03efa640aa35678b
2 Input
2 Outputs
- f850633d74c3f421902a5ea745d36eac0035ab70368cc60c03efa640aa35678b:0
- f850633d74c3f421902a5ea745d36eac0035ab70368cc60c03efa640aa35678b:1
value 18898300
address 336KSWy7x5ef5aLHmh7TfcagyXbRzhyq4A
value 100000000
address 17LBpQpcZ15hRmujaAoQCvgcwadoArFUGE